    Some of the more old school players at my club prefer the old rules to the new. I'm not sure whether it's because they're conservative and have grown accustomed to it or whether it is because they dislike the pace of the new rules. Could be a combination of the 2. Personally, I prefer the new rules to the old for 2 reasons. First, it stops the stupendously long tie breaks + exchange of service. Second, I think it makes you work harder for your game. Any mistakes are punished, so it's a positive kind of pressure. I can appreciate the dislike of the new rules for this reason also, especially if one is only after a friendly/leisurely game.
